Our
Experience
Our experience includes:
-
Strategic assessment of the value proposition and realignment/reengineering
of the human resources function and organization; e.g.: for an
international integrated oil company
-
Redesign/reengineering of benefits administration processes and
the development of detailed implementation plans ; e.g.: for a
pharmaceutical company
-
Outsourcing feasibility studies; e.g.: for outsourcing the benefits
administration process of a major Canadian university.
-
A major study for 30 government departments to examine recruitment
and retention issues
-
Review of organizational structure and role/job definitions; e.g.:
development of job descriptions for over 120 different jobs in
an international courier company; defined and described the role
of the executive director for a major national philanthropic organization
-
Numerous projects involving job evaluation, pay equity analysis
and development of total reward/compensation programs. Industry
sectors include, for example: steel and equipment manufacturing,
municipal government, hotels, courier companies, arts funding
organizations, cement manufacturing, distributors, etc.
-
A major job evaluation and pay equity engagement with the Ontario
Hospital Association. This project involved approximately 20 consultants
in providing analysis to some 170 hospitals. Also acted as project
director on pay equity engagements for over 12 hospitals. Assistance
was provided to a number of these hospitals to also develop new
compensation structures for their non-unionized jobs
-
Design of a new job evaluation system and classification/pay structure
for the Ontario government. This project covered the senior management
levels of all Ontario government ministries (approximately 2,000
positions, representing the top 6 or 7 levels up to the Assistant
Deputy Minister). The evaluation system used a computerized program
called COMPEAT
-
Salary surveys for various private and public sector organizations
for a range of occupations and professions, including for example:
a survey on executive positions' compensation; a national and
international survey on performance and incentive based compensation
systems for health care providers in Canada
